Delays of up to 70 minutes could affect trains calling at Maidenhead, Slough, Burnham, Taplow and Twyford today due to signalling problems.
Train operator First Great Western said on its website the hitch, which has affected services travelling between London Paddington and Reading, has been fixed but delays and some cancellations are likely to continue until 4pm today.
FGW tickets are being accepted on alternative routes from London Waterloo to Windsor and Eton Riverside as well as on Chiltern Railways and Cross Country services.
